Un Result
de JDBC. Para obtener documentación de esta clase, consulta
java.sql.ResultSetMetaData
.
Métodos
Método | Tipo de datos que se muestra | Descripción breve |
---|---|---|
get | String |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getCatalogName(int) . |
get | String |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nClassName(int) . |
get | Integer |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nCount() . |
get | Integer |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nDisplaySize(int) . |
get | String |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nLabel(int) . |
get | String |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nName(int) . |
get | Integer |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nType(int) . |
get | String |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nTypeName(int) . |
get | Integer |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getPrecision(int) . |
get | Integer |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getScale(int) . |
get | String |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getSchemaName(int) . |
get | String |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getTableName(int) . |
is | Boolean |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isAutoIncrement(int) . |
is | Boolean |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isCaseSensitive(int) . |
is | Boolean |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isCurrency(int) . |
is | Boolean |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isDefinitelyWritable(int) . |
is | Integer |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isNullable(int) . |
is | Boolean |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isReadOnly(int) . |
is | Boolean |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isSearchable(int) . |
is | Boolean |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isSigned(int) . |
is | Boolean |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isWritable(int) . |
Documentación detallada
getCatalogName(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getCatalogName(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
String
: Es el nombre del catálogo de la tabla en la columna designada o una cadena vacía si no corresponde.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
getColumnClassName(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nClassName(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
String
: Es el nombre completamente calificado de la clase de los valores de la columna designada.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
getColumnCount()
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nCount()
.
Volver
Integer
: Es la cantidad de columnas en este conjunto de resultados.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
getColumnDisplaySize(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nDisplaySize(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Integer
: Es la cantidad máxima de caracteres permitida como el ancho de las columnas designadas.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
getColumnLabel(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nLabel(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
String
: Es el título sugerido de la columna designada, que suele especificarse con una cláusula AS
de SQL.
Muestra lo mismo que get
si no se especifica un AS
.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
getColumnName(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nName(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
String
: Es el nombre de la columna designada.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
getColumnType(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nType(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Integer
: Es el tipo de SQL de la columna designada.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
getColumnTypeName(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getColumnTypeName(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
String
: Es el nombre de tipo específico de la base de datos de la columna designada. Muestra el nombre de tipo completamente calificado si es un tipo definido por el usuario.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
getPrecision(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getPrecision(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Integer
: Es el tamaño máximo de la columna determinada. Para los datos numéricos, esta es la precisión máxima. Para los datos de caracteres, esta es la longitud en caracteres. En el caso de los datos de fecha y hora, es la longitud en caracteres de la representación de cadena (suponiendo la precisión máxima permitida del componente de segundos fraccionarios). Para los datos binarios, esta es la longitud en bytes. Para el tipo de datos ROWID
, esta es la longitud en bytes. Muestra 0 para los tipos en los que el tamaño de la columna no es aplicable.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
getScale(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getScale(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Integer
: Es la cantidad de dígitos a la derecha del punto decimal de las columnas designadas. Muestra 0 para los tipos de datos en los que no se aplica la escala.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
getSchemaName(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getSchemaName(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
String
: Es el esquema de la tabla de la columna designada.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
getTableName(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#getTableName(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
String
: Es el nombre de la tabla de la columna designada o una cadena vacía si no corresponde.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
isAutoIncrement(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isAutoIncrement(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Boolean
: true
si la columna especificada se numeró automáticamente; false
, de lo contrario.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
isCaseSensitive(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isCaseSensitive(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Boolean
: true
si la columna especificada distingue mayúsculas de minúsculas; false
de lo contrario.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
isCurrency(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isCurrency(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Boolean
: Es true
si la columna especificada es un valor monetario; false
de lo contrario.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
isDefinitelyWritable(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isDefinitelyWritable(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Boolean
: true
si las operaciones de escritura en la columna designada se realizan correctamente; false
, de lo contrario.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
isNullable(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isNullable(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Integer
: Es el estado de nulabilidad de la columna especificada, que es Jdbc.ResultSetMetaData.columnNoNulls
, Jdbc.ResultSetMetaData.columnNullable
o Jdbc.ResultSetMetaData.columnNullableUnknown
.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
isReadOnly(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isReadOnly(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Boolean
: true
si la columna designada no se puede escribir de forma definitiva; false
, de lo contrario.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
isSearchable(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isSearchable(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Boolean
: true
si una cláusula where puede usar la columna especificada; false
de lo contrario.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
isSigned(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isSigned(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Boolean
: true
si los valores de la columna especificada son números con signo; false
, de lo contrario.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request
isWritable(column)
Para obtener documentación sobre este método, consulta
java.sql.ResultSetMetaData#isWritable(int)
.
Parámetros
Nombre | Tipo | Descripción |
---|---|---|
column | Integer | Es el índice de la columna que se examinará (la primera columna es 1, la segunda es 2, y así sucesivamente). |
Volver
Boolean
: true
si es posible escribir en la columna designada; false
de lo contrario.
Autorización
Las secuencias de comandos que usan este método requieren autorización con uno o más de los siguientes ámbitos:
-
https://www.googleapis.com/auth/script.external_request